How to Transfer Ownership of a Burial Plot Step 1 Get the Deed From the Cemetery. Step 2 Review the State and Local Laws. Step 3 Prove You Are the Current Owner. Step 4 Fill Out the Cemetery Plot Deed Transfer Form. Step 5 Complete the Transfer and Get the New Deed.
This Quit Claim Deed document facilitates the transfer of cemetery spaces from one owner to another. It includes essential fields for grantors, recipients, and notary requirements. Use this file to ensure a smooth transfer with all necessary details documented.

What Important Details Should Be Included in Your Documents and Letters? Legal name and registered information of the owner and the purchaser. The agreed upon transfer date and amount paid by the buyer. Declaration that ALL rights are being transferred to the new owner. Description of the plot and the rules governing it.
